- There are three disused forges in the parrish, namely James Carroll's Galross, Frank Tiquin's Tayborolaross; and Joe Feigherys, Cloghan.
Carrols were smiths for over seventy years.
Tiquins were smiths for about fifty years.
Feigherys were smiths for eighty years.
Joe Feighery lived in the village of Cloghan.
James Carroll lives about half a mile from the village of Cloghan on the road side.(continues on next page)- Collector
